Equivalent & Substitute Parts for S506-5-R Glass Cartridge Fuse

Part Overview

The S506-5-R is a 5 A, 250 V AC/DC slow blow glass cartridge fuse manufactured by Eaton Electronics Division. This component is designed for use in 5mm x 20mm fuse holders and provides overcurrent protection in electrical circuits. The part maintains active product status with 818 units in current inventory. Substitute Part Grouping Explanation

Substitution eligibility for the S506-5-R is determined by strict equivalence across the following critical parameters: current rating (5 A), voltage rating (250 V AC), fuse type (cartridge glass), response time (slow blow), physical package dimensions (5mm x 20mm), breaking capacity (50 A), and mounting requirement (holder-based installation). All identified substitute parts match these core electrical and mechanical specifications. Substitutes are grouped into two categories: direct manufacturer equivalents from Eaton Electronics Division and parametric equivalents from alternative manufacturers (Littelfuse Inc. and SCHURTER Inc.). Parametric equivalents maintain identical functional performance while differing in melting I²t characteristics, DC cold resistance, or approval agency certifications. These variations do not affect interchangeability within the specified 5mm x 20mm holder form factor.

Engineering Selection Recommendations

Direct Manufacturer Equivalents (Eaton Electronics Division)

The parts BK/S506-5-R, BK/GDC-5A, and GDC-5A are direct equivalents manufactured by Eaton and share identical electrical characteristics, melting I²t values (142.5), and DC cold resistance (0.00985 Ohms) with the primary S506-5-R part. These components carry the same approval agencies (BSI, CCC, CSA, CURUS, IMQ, PSE/JET, SEMKO, VDE) and maintain ROHS3 compliance. BK/S506-5-R offers the highest inventory availability (2707 units) among Eaton products. Selection of Eaton equivalents is appropriate when supply chain standardization on a single manufacturer is required or when existing certification documentation references Eaton products.

Littelfuse Parametric Equivalents

The Littelfuse 218 series (0218005.MXP, 0218005.HXP) and 213 series (0213005.MXP, 0213005.MXBP, 0213005.TXP) maintain the required 5 A, 250 V, slow blow characteristics and 5mm x 20mm form factor. The 218 series exhibits a melting I²t of 111 (lower than S506-5-R at 142.5), while the 213 series exhibits a melting I²t of 314 (higher than S506-5-R). Both series are ROHS3 compliant and carry comprehensive approval certifications (CCC, CE, CSA, PSE, SEMKO, UL, VDE). The 0218005.MXP variant offers the largest inventory (42700 units) among all substitute options. Littelfuse parts are suitable for applications where multi-source qualification is established or when Littelfuse certifications align with end-use requirements.

SCHURTER Parametric Equivalents

The SCHURTER FST 5x20 series (0034.3124) and SMD-FST series (0034.5624.11) provide parametric equivalence with melting I²t values of 102, lower than the S506-5-R baseline. Both maintain 5 A, 250 V, slow blow operation in the 5mm x 20mm package with 50 A breaking capacity and ROHS3 compliance. Approval certifications include CCC, cURus, PSE/JET, and VDE. SCHURTER parts are appropriate for applications where European certification emphasis (VDE) is prioritized or when SCHURTER qualification is pre-established in design documentation.

Q: Can I use a substitute part with a different melting I²t value?

A: Melting I²t differences indicate variations in thermal response characteristics. Substitution with different melting I²t values is permissible only when the application circuit design and thermal protection requirements accommodate the alternative response profile. The S506-5-R baseline melting I²t is 142.5; Littelfuse 218 series is 111 (faster response), and Littelfuse 213 series is 314 (slower response).
